Lara Kuehl appointed to the Attorney General’s B Panel

Serle Court is delighted to announce that Lara Kuehl has been appointed to the London B Panel of Junior Counsel to the Crown. Her appointment will take effect on 1st September 2025 for a period of five years. Lara was previously on the London C Panel from 2022.

The Attorney General maintains three advisory panels of junior counsel to undertake civil and EU work for all government departments.  B Panel members deal with substantial cases on behalf of the UK government, generally where knowledge and experience of a particular field is required.
